
Sonny E. is the reinvention of ‘Acid House & NRG King’ Adamski aka Adam Paul Tinley, who released his new track ‘Time’ on 5th September – available across all the usual platforms.
“I know there’s an infinite number of songs about time but not as many as there are songs about love and/or sex and dancing so I’m very happy to add to the tradition. Aptly, for the subject matter, it’s taken me around half of my life to complete this song …one or two lines every couple of years …I’m not sure if spending so much time on a simple two-minute song means I’m a good or bad artist? but I’m in no particular rush and very satisfied with the end result. It is also a hybrid of my two main passions – rockabilly, a timeless sound, which has of course existed since the birth of pop culture as we know it, and AI which for me is the most inspiring technological development since the advent of sampling as an artform. Therefore, I consider myself a teddy boy timelord and this is augmented reality rockabilly …. cyberbilly.” SONNY E.

Sonny E. was a teenager in the era when new and exciting youth subcultures frequently sprang up, and the new and updated musical genres affiliated with them constantly mutated and fed into each other. As an avid music junkie and driven by aesthetics, Sonny absorbed the best of these deep into his psyche; most significantly Rockabilly and its wilder offspring, Psychobilly, Electro (both mainstream and underground), so-called ‘GenderBenders’ and the heavily automated electronic music that set the stage for Acid House and Techno…some of the key artists that had a profound influence on the spongelike Sonny were The Cramps, The Meteors, Alan Vega and Martin Rev (both their solo works and together as Suicide), Devo, The Human League, Mantronix and a plethora of predominantly American 1950s trailblazers…

Consequently Sonny E. had now truly embarked on his Cyberbilly odyssey. He taught himself to play simple chords and used the preset basslines on a Casiotone MT-40 home keyboard, then with a rudimentary synthesizer built by a school friend from Maplin components he progressed to making plinky plonky dance beats. He also spent many, many lonesome hours in his bedroom working out how to play twangy rockabilly riffs on cheap Woolworth’s guitars…
So obsessed by music was Sonny that he “left school at 16 unqualified and unwilling to do anything work related, and was soon after ejected from the family home by my father”. Aged 17 and living in squats in Hackney he was further fuelled on his mission by attending some early Sigue Sigue Sputnik gigs. “I loved their look, live sound and manifesto,” he says. “Still do!”
Not long after this he was to discover the music of pioneering American DJ /producers like Adonis, Dj Pierre and Derrick May, who formed the basis of what evolved into the seemingly unstoppable global Rave culture we now know… He became captivated by their other worldly sounds and the thrilling social scene they begat.
He also visited the island of Ibiza in the days before it was taken over by ‘superclubs’ and rampant consumerism and had his mind blown by the extremely diverse and influential Balearic style being spun by DJs Alfredo, Pippi and Cesare – ‘The Race’ by Yello having a particularly preemptive impact.
Sonny was engulfed by this whole shebang for many years to come, spending three decades in the greatest nightspots of the world providing sci-fi beats for hedonists – under various guises – but in recent years has eschewed all that to focus on his primary passion, and is now spurting all his creative juice into what he terms Cyberbilly – a very literal description of his music which has its basis in original Rockabilly (the Big Bang of popular culture) while embracing the sounds and methods of contemporary technology…. a one-man band like psychobilly originator Hasil Adkins, the self-styled Teddy Boy Timelord comes armed with simply a laptop and a microphone, swaggering down the information superhighway to source the most rockin’ elements from 1955-2099.
